Understanding The Process Of Injection Molding

By Genevive B. Mata


The improvements in machinery and manufacturing processes have led to more reliable and cost effective means of achieving the desired output. Injection molding is a popular choice for many companies and involves the creation of plastics by pushing the molten material into a mold in extreme pressures. It is a suitable option in production and considered to be most affordable for manufacturers.

In order to produce the desired outcome in manufacture, the creation of a mold cavity with plastic muse be achieved. Once it has cooled down, a solid substance will be formed and can be applied in different applications in industry. Such molds may be developed under higher pressures and involved a mold clamp to ensure that all procedures are completed.

The mold process delivers precision results for large quantities of product and within an efficient time span. It has become a favorable choice for most manufacturers as it is able to deliver large quantities of product within a shorter period of time and with accuracy. Design outcomes can be achieved with the necessary combinations of materials and parts in the process.

In order to produce high quality items, it requires an investment in the highest possible quality equipment and tools. The cost of such machinery is considerably high because of the construction needed to withstand high pressure. The tools include a steel or aluminum consistency for durable and strong performance.
